Antenna solutions
ProAnt provides innovative and high-performance antenna solutions, suitable for M2M and IoT applications. Their technology is currently utilised by leading companies such as Lantronix, Raspberry Pi and Espressif.
ProAnt's embedded and external antenna product line ranges from 150 MHz up to 6 GHz and cover technologies such as:
- GSM/UMTS/LTE
- GPS/GLONASS and other GNSS services
- WLAN/Bluetooth/Zigbee
- LPWAN
- Various ISM bands

Embedded OnBoard™ SMD antenna
The Onboard™ SMD antenna family are surface mounted sheet metal antennas, with packaged tape on reel, making them suitable for high volume manufacturing.
One of their key features which eliminates the need of a dielectric substrate, is the capacitively-loaded footprint of the supporting pins on the antenna, that significantly reduces losses and increases the performance. Another benefit of ProAnt's OnBoard™ SMD antennas is the space that can be utilised underneath the antenna to place other components.
Key features:
- Frequency stability
- Relatively omnidirectional radiation pattern
- Mixed Polarity
Embedded InSide™ Internal antenna
Ideal for inside mounting on non-conductive surfaces such as plastic, ProAnt's Embedded InSide™ antennas are a PCB type antenna paired with a cable and connector and are available in various frequencies.
Two key features of ProAnt's Inside™ antennas is the adhesive tape that is included to enable it to be mounted, and the larger antenna size, which provides enhanced performance. Customisation is also available on the cable, cable length, and the connector.
Frequency Ranges:
- 868/915 MHz
- GSM/3G
- 2.4 GHz
- 2.4/5 GHz
- NB-IoT
External Ex-It antennas
ProAnt's External Ex-It antennas provide exceptionally strong performance as they can be mounted externally via a short cable out of the box. They come in various frequencies and can be customised with a range of different options upon request.
Frequency Ranges:
- 169 MHz
- 434 MHz
- 868 MHz
- GSM/3G
- 2.4 GHz
- 2.4/5 GHz
